India's home theatre market

A small base growing at one of the fastest rates in consumer electronics

India's home theatre market is early-stage but expanding rapidly, driven by streaming, rising disposable incomes and the desire to recreate a cinema experience at home. Global estimates vary widely by how "home theatre" is defined, but every major research house agrees Asia-Pacific — led by India and China — is the fastest-growing region.

$2.18B
Projected size of India's home theatre market by 2033, up from $457.9M in 2024.
Source: IMARC Group, 2025
$12.36B
Global home theatre market in 2024, forecast to reach $19.98B by 2030 (8.3% CAGR).
Source: Grand View Research, 2025
Asia-Pacific
The fastest-growing home theatre region globally, driven by urbanisation and a growing middle class in India and China.
Source: Grand View Research, 2025
₹1.73T
India's projected annual spend on entertainment & media, expanding the addressable market for home entertainment.
Source: Government of India, via Market Research Future, 2025
39.9%
North America's share of the global home theatre market in 2024 — a gap India is now closing fastest.
Source: Grand View Research, 2025
14.4%
Alternative global home theatre CAGR estimate (2025–2032), reaching ~$45.9B — illustrating how forecasts diverge by definition.
Source: Maximize Market Research, 2025

The streaming surge driving demand

India is on track to become the world's largest streaming-subscription market

The single biggest tailwind for home theatre and cinema seating is the collapse of "going out to watch" into "watching at home." India's connected-TV base nearly doubled in a single year, and subscription streaming is scaling toward figures that would make India the largest such market on earth.

+85%
Growth in India's Connected TV audience in one year — from 69.7M (2024) to 129.2M (2025).
Source: Ormax Media, 2025
357.4M
Projected India SVOD subscriptions by 2030, up from 135.6M in 2024 and 52.6M in 2020.
Source: industry analyst forecasts, via Apprupt, 2026
$9.17B
Projected India online-video revenue by 2030, more than double the $4.31B recorded in 2024.
Source: industry analyst forecasts, via Apprupt, 2026
#1
India is forecast to overtake China as the world's largest SVOD subscription market by 2030.
Source: industry analyst forecasts, via Apprupt, 2026
148.2M
Active paid OTT subscriptions in India in 2025, across direct and bundled plans.
Source: Ormax Media, 2025
Dozens
India now has dozens of OTT platforms competing for viewers, up from a handful a decade ago — deepening the case for a dedicated viewing space.
Source: as widely reported, 2025

The recliner & reclining-furniture market

Motorised recline is set to overtake manual — and India leads Asia's growth

Recliners are moving from a niche import into a mainstream comfort category in India, with the country posting the highest growth rate in the Asia-Pacific region. Globally, the most important shift is mechanism: power (motorised) recliners are growing faster than manual and are projected to become the majority of revenue before the decade's end.

$416.8M
India recliner chair market in 2025, forecast to reach $608M by 2034.
Source: IMARC Group, 2026
Highest in APAC
India shows the highest recliner-market CAGR in the Asia-Pacific region, the fastest-growing global region for recliners.
Source: Cognitive Market Research, 2026
Power rising
Motorised recliners are gaining share fast. Estimates differ on the exact split — some research houses already put power above 60% of the global market, others project it overtaking manual around 2028 — but the direction is consistent across every firm.
Sources: DataHorizzon Research, 2024; Fortune Business Insights, 2025; Dataintelo, 2026
8.2%
Projected CAGR of power recliners through 2034 — faster than the overall recliner-sofa market's 6.3%.
Source: Dataintelo, 2026 (one estimate)
$19.8B
Projected global recliner-sofa market by 2034, up from $11.4B in 2025.
Source: Dataintelo, 2026
Premium tier
Power recliners are already the majority choice above the $1,500 price point, favoured for ergonomics and elderly users.
Source: Dataintelo, 2026

Global recliner mechanism share, 2025 — manual vs power

One estimate: manual 52.7% / power 47.3% (Dataintelo, 2026). Other firms already place power in the majority (DataHorizzon Research, 2024). Direction of travel: power gaining on manual.

India's furniture market context

North India leads demand — and buyers are moving online

Home theatre seating sits inside a furniture market being reshaped by urbanisation, e-commerce and a shift from unorganised to branded, made-to-order buying. North India — Sky Recliners' home region — leads national furniture demand.

$72.1B
Projected India furniture market by 2033, up from $27.25B in 2024 (11.42% CAGR).
Source: Renub Research, 2025
14.7%
CAGR of India's online furniture market (2025–2033), rising from $1.62B (2024) to $5.56B (2033).
Source: IMARC Group, 2025
33.2%
North India's share of national furniture demand, led by Delhi-NCR's real-estate expansion.
Source: IMARC Group, 2025
70.6%
Share of India's furniture revenue from the residential segment.
Source: IMARC Group, 2025
751.5M
India internet users (52.4% penetration) as of January 2024 — the base enabling online furniture purchase.
Source: IMARC Group, 2025
Made-to-order
Consumers are shifting from "just functional" to aspirational, customised furniture — favouring factory-direct, configurable brands.
Source: Renub Research, 2025

The ergonomics case

Why comfort seating is a health story, not just a luxury one

Beyond entertainment, recliners intersect with a large and growing occupational-health problem. Prolonged sitting and poor posture are among the biggest drivers of disability worldwide — context that reframes reclining, lumbar-supporting seating as a wellness purchase.

619M
People affected by low back pain globally in 2020 — the largest single contributor to years lived with disability; projected to reach 843M by 2050.
Source: Global Burden of Disease 2021 / The Lancet Rheumatology, 2023
up to 80.8%
Prevalence of work-related musculoskeletal disorders reported among office workers in a 2026 systematic review.
Source: Frontiers in Public Health, 2026
52%
Share of sitting professionals reporting lower-back musculoskeletal disorder in the prior 12 months in an Indian study.
Source: Int. Journal of Community Medicine & Public Health, 2022
70–77%
Share of working hours office workers spend sedentary, measured by accelerometer — much of it in unbroken 20–60 minute stretches.
Sources: J. Occupational & Environmental Medicine, 2014; Australian accelerometer study, 2012
40–60%
Greater cardiovascular-mortality risk associated with sedentary time exceeding ~10.6 hours per day.
Source: Frontiers in Public Health, 2026
~39%
Share of low-back-pain disability (years lived with disability) attributable to occupational ergonomic factors, smoking and high BMI combined — a leading set of modifiable drivers.
Source: Global Burden of Disease 2021 / The Lancet Rheumatology, 2023

Methodology & sources

Market-sizing figures on this page are estimates published by independent research firms. Definitions of "home theatre," "recliner" and "furniture" differ between firms, so absolute values vary — we cite the specific source beside each figure and, where forecasts diverge sharply, note more than one estimate. First-party figures are labelled Sky Recliners data and reflect the company's own operations. Journalists and researchers are welcome to cite these statistics with attribution to Sky Recliners.
